Create an open-door policy ๐Ÿ”‘

Creating an open-door policy means that your employees can come to you with any questions or concerns. Having an open-door policy promotes transparency and encourages your employees to communicate openly. It can create a sense of trust and loyalty.๐Ÿ”“

You should make sure that your employees feel comfortable talking to you, and you listen to them without any judgment. You can also set up scheduled meetings to discuss their ideas, concerns, and feedback. ๐Ÿ—“๏ธ

Encourage communication between employees ๐Ÿ’ฌ

Itโ€™s essential to encourage communication between employees as it helps in building a robust team. There should be an understanding among employees, and everyone should be aware of each otherโ€™s roles and responsibilities. ๐Ÿ‘ฅ

Effective team communication can solve problems, streamline projects, and build a positive work culture. Encourage employees to share ideas, knowledge and communicate their thoughts. You can also arrange team-building activities to boost team communication. ๐Ÿš€

Use communication tools ๐Ÿ“ฑ

You can take advantage of various communication tools like emails, chats, and video conferencing to facilitate and enhance communication. You can use these tools to track progress on projects, share ideas and discuss feedback. ๐Ÿ“ง

The right communication tool can also be an essential factor in maintaining a good work-life balance. Ensure that you opt for the tools that are suitable for your business requirements and that your employees are comfortable using them. ๐Ÿ› ๏ธ

Celebrate success and recognize achievements ๐ŸŽ‰

Celebrate success and recognize your employeeโ€™s achievements to show that you appreciate and value them. It can boost their morale and help them feel motivated and engaged in their work. Appreciation can go a long way in showing your employees that you recognize their hard work. ๐Ÿ™Œ

You can create a culture of positive reinforcement by congratulating employees publically, providing incentives, and rewards. It m makes them feel respected and valued, which can ultimately lead to a work environment that is productive and motivating. ๐ŸŒŸ
